I had a cheap wired Steelseries Arctis Nova headset that I hated. Absolutely terrible mic. Could barely pick up anything. The Sonar software they offer isn't great but with a lot of effort I was able to make it boost the mic enough that I could use it. It creates virtual devices that you manage separately depending on what software you're using. It can be a pain in the butt. I was gifted a Corsair Void v2 to replace it and it is phenomenal. Very good mic. More comfortable. Wireless. Long battery life. Loud. Clear. Works great out of the box without additional software. Recommended.

I bought the Corsair HS80 Max, because I heard such good things about the HS80. The main difference between the two was that the Max had Bluetooth. Sweet, just a bonus right? Wrong. The mic was AWFUL. Horrible tinny sound and no matter what I did, it still sounded shit. Looked it online and yep, loads of people with the same problem. Returned it, and decided I’d just keep to my original Void wireless, even if they are ancient now. I’m never buying a Bluetooth headset ever again.
